Synopsis
The UK's most original afternoon sports radio show with Paul Hawksbee and Andy Jacobs - an eclectic mix of chat, comedy and the downright crazy. This podcast contains the funniest moments and best interviews from the show. Listen to the show live every weekday between 1pm and 4pm on talkSPORT and talkSPORT.com the world's biggest sports radio station.
